Thread Tap Art-Pol M12x1.75 mm machine tap, metric M12×1.75
The Art-Pol machine tap M12x1.75 mm is a precision cutting tool for creating internal M12×1.75 metric threads in metal components. Intended for machine tapping operations, this tap is made to cut or form threads with the standard 1.75 mm pitch and nominal 12 mm diameter. It is suitable for use in production environments and repair shops where a reliable, dimensionally accurate internal thread is required.
This machine tap provides consistent thread accuracy and repeatability when used with appropriate tapping holders or machine spindles. Its geometry is tailored for efficient chip evacuation and stable cutting action in a range of common engineering metals. The tap enables faster cycle times in automated or semi-automated tapping setups compared with manual tapping, while maintaining the dimensional tolerances expected for metric M12 threads.
Mount the tap securely in a compatible tapping holder or machine spindle designed for through or blind tapping as required. Select appropriate cutting speed, feed, and cutting fluid based on the workpiece material. For blind holes, establish the correct drill size and depth before tapping; for through holes, ensure proper support for chip evacuation. Advance the tap steadily under machine control, allowing the tool to cut the full thread depth, then reverse to break and clear chips if the machine cycle requires it. Inspect the produced threads with gauge or thread measurement tools to verify dimensional conformity.
Use recommended drill size and correct lubrication for the material being machined; ensure machine spindle alignment and secure tool holding to prevent chatter and premature wear. Replace the tap when thread quality degrades or tool wear is evident.
